1-(3-Nitrophenyl)piperazine Chemical Properties,Usage,Production

Synthesis

110-85-0

402-67-5

54054-85-2

1. 28.4 g (0.33 mol, 5.5 equiv) of piperazine is dissolved in 50 mL of DMSO. 2. 6.4 mL (60 mmol) of m-fluoronitrobenzene is added to this solution. 2. 6.4 mL (60 mmol) of m-fluoronitrobenzene was added to the above solution. 3. The reaction mixture was heated at 100°C for 60 hours. 4. 4. When the reaction is complete, cool to room temperature and slowly pour the mixture into 530 mL of water. 5. The precipitate formed was collected by filtration and the filtrate was extracted with ether (Et2O). 6. 6. The organic phases were combined, dried over anhydrous magnesium sulfate (MgSO4), and concentrated under reduced pressure. 7. The crude product was purified by column chromatography using a solvent mixture of dichloromethane (CH2Cl2) and methanol (MeOH) (9:1, v/v/v) as eluent. 8. The target component was collected and concentrated under reduced pressure to give 8.04 g of orange oil, which was crystallized as 1-(3-nitrophenyl)piperazine after standing at room temperature in 65% yield. Compound characterization data. Molecular formula: C10H13N3O2 Molecular weight: 207.26 g/mol 1H NMR (CDCl3) δ (ppm): 7.70 (t, J = 2 Hz, 1H, H-2'); 7.64 (ddd, J = 8 Hz, 2 Hz, 0.6 Hz, 1H, H-4'); 7.36 (t, J = 8 Hz, 1H, H-5'); 7.17 (ddd, J = 8 Hz, 2 Hz, 0.6 Hz, 1H, H-6') ; 3.30-3.18 (m, 4H, H-3, H-5); 3.09-2.97 (m, 4H, H-2, H-6).
